Local attractions

Make the most of Exmoor stays by signing up immediately for an Exmoor Wildlife Safari, clambering into the back of a Land Rover for guided excursions through the park, keeping eyes peeled for deer and the rare Exmoor ponies. There are no long treks to get going either, as the tour guides will pick guests up at Dunster, Dulverton or Exford, all within about 25 minutes’ drive. Get a closer look at some of the area’s wildlife (as well as some more exotic specimens) at Tropiquaria, a small Art Deco zoo in a former BBC radio transmitter station 10 minutes from base, or travel a little further (30 minutes) to the Exmoor Pony Centre to learn about the native ponies and even take a ride in the park. If interest in watery getaways was piqued by beach days in Minehead and Watchet, but less salt would be preferable, head along to Wimbleball Lake or Clatworthy Reservoir (both within 15 minutes) – the first for birdwatching, trout fishing and lessons in windsurfing, sailing, canoeing and rowing, and the second for pretty scenery, boat hire and fishing. Dip a toe into the past by visiting the Museum of Somerset and the military and cricket museums in Taunton, half an hour away, then dive further in with trips to Dunster Castle, Fyne Court and Knightshayes, all within 35 minutes of base. Prefer to finish hols on a celebratory note? Stumble over to Yearlstone Vineyard (40 minutes) for a tipple or two.
